This typeface is a clean sans with rounded, geometric construction and smooth, continuous curves. Strokes maintain an even, steady thickness, producing a consistent color in text. Counters are generally generous and circular (notably in O, o, and 0), and many forms show open apertures that keep interior spaces clear at small sizes. Terminals are mostly straight and crisp, while joins in letters like n, m, and h read soft and controlled rather than sharply angular. Uppercase proportions feel balanced and slightly compact, and the lowercase maintains a clear, readable rhythm with simple, unembellished shapes.
It works well for interface copy, product labels, and general-purpose branding where clarity and a contemporary look are needed. The even stroke and open interiors support comfortable reading in short paragraphs, while the simple geometric shapes also hold up in headlines and signage.
The overall tone is modern and approachable, leaning toward a friendly neutrality rather than stark minimalism. Its rounded geometry gives it a calm, contemporary feel that suits everyday communication without calling too much attention to itself.
The design appears intended as a versatile, contemporary sans that prioritizes legibility and an even typographic texture. Its rounded geometry and restrained details suggest a goal of broad usability across both display and text contexts.
In the sample text, spacing and letterfit create an even horizontal flow with few dark spots, suggesting a focus on steady paragraph texture. Numerals appear clear and practical, with straightforward forms designed for quick recognition.
